在项目开发的需求明确之后,需要开发多端应用的项目需求,按照传统方式开的是需要花费更多的时间,写更多的代码,对于项目的上线和发布都有一定时间限制,不能做到同时发布,需要对应着每一端,相应的开发写对应的代码。消耗更多的时间和资源,开发速度和效果也不会太高,不过在现在的开发框架中,已经出现了许多多端开发的框架,这种基本都是用于移动端的开发。对于现在开发的需求,是大大的提升了开发者的速度,和大大减少了项目多端分布的开发短板。
虽然现在已经不少的框架能多端开发,但是我在之中是选择了uni-app这个框架。
为什么在那么多的前端框架中选择了uni-app呢?主要还是因为自身项目开发的需要,项目需要开发h5端,小程序以及APP端的开发,在经过多方比较选择,对比之下还是觉得uni-app这个框架更加的适合,所以就选择了。并且框架的论坛活跃,有大量用户使用,可以在大家的经验基础上学习,探索,发现,并且应用项目上。
uni-app 是一个使用 Vue.js 开发所有前端应用的框架,开发者编写一套代码,可发布到iOS、Android、H5、以及各种小程序(微信/支付宝/百度/头条/QQ/钉钉)等多个平台。使用这框架开发刚刚好是符合。
虽然在此之前也是没有做过多端开发,更加没有做过APP的开发,但是这框架是基于Vue.js开发的,并且是小程序的强化版的开发模式,只要开发过微信小程序的和有Vue基础的开发者,对uni-app的开发使用,是没有任何问题的,使用门槛还是不会很高,也不需要另外在去学其他的东西,这样学习成本也不用很高,会开发小程序和vue就可以了。
使用这个框架也是新手上路了,咋开发中当然也会遇到很多的问题,但是有活跃的论坛还有官网的技术群,我们就可以在群里或者论坛提出问题,寻找帮助,这样就可以很快的解决开发过程中遇到的问题了。使用uni-app开发的效率高,还提供了大量适合手机页面的基础组件,还提供了扩展组件uni UI,插件市场更是有600多的插件供开发者使用。
选择了使用这个框架,我觉得这是前端框架中非常不错的,推荐大家使用。提高了开发效率,减少了学习成本,前端开发的强有力助手,感谢uni-app官方开发的框架。自己也要好好加油,努力的学习提升自己技术。
领取专属 10元无门槛券
私享最新 技术干货